Dual-purpose Deep cycling and cranking power all packed into one battery.
Longer life
Lasts up to 2 times longer than traditional flat-plate batteries.
Higher reserve capacity
Constant performance quality, which keeps your battery running at the same level even as it's being discharged.
Optimal starting power
More power in the initial 1, 3, 5, and 10 seconds of the starting process than comparably rated conventional lead-acid batteries.
Longer shelf-life (lower self-discharge)
Ideal for seasonal use, fully charged it can sit unused for up to 12 months at room temperature (or below) and still start a vehicle.
